Two-Factor Verification for Robust Security

In today's increasingly digital world, safeguarding your online accounts has never been more check here crucial. Text verification emerges as a powerful tool in this endeavor, bolstering account security by adding an extra layer of authentication. Such measures involves sending a unique, time-sensitive code via SMS to the user's mobile device. Upon this code, users must enter it into the designated field on the platform or service they're attempting to access. This two-factor authentication confirms the user's identity, effectively stopping unauthorized access and reducing the risk of account compromise.

Utilizing text verification, users fortify their accounts against malicious actors who may attempt to obtain access through stolen credentials or brute-force attacks. This method provides an extra protection that adds a significant degree of confidence and peace of mind for users worried about the security of their online information.
